Output 852311777add324172cfe6d6d710fdfc46e0c0f5bef3cbe4f07aa89f23bee953:4

value
106733602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89453ea5f5ba240890a63e8d0691c3e930e5f49d OP_EQUAL
address
MLQykvDsf1VPSexJKjbgYvRfN57c1A5cLp
transaction
852311777add324172cfe6d6d710fdfc46e0c0f5bef3cbe4f07aa89f23bee953
spent
true